Company History and Business Evolution

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C traces its roots back to the early 1960s when Sabre (then Semi-Automated Business Research Environment) was developed as a computerized reservation system for American Airlines. Over the decades, Sabre evolved into a global travel technology powerhouse, and in the 1990s, it began focusing on hospitality solutions. The formation of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C as a distinct business unit occurred in the early 2000s, following the acquisition of several key hospitality technology companies. In 2003, Sabre acquired SynXis, a leading provider of central reservation systems for independent hotels, which became the cornerstone of its hospitality portfolio. Throughout the 2010s, the company expanded through strategic acquisitions, including the purchase of InnQuest Software in 2016, adding a property management system (PMS) tailored for small to mid-sized hotels. Later, the acquisition of Abacus in 2018 strengthened its presence in the Asia-Pacific region. A major milestone came in 2020 when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C launched the Sabre SynXis Platform, a cloud-native, microservices-based architecture that unified CRS, PMS, and distribution capabilities. This platform enabled hotels to operate more flexibly, especially during the COVID-19 pandemic, when agility was critical. The company also invested heavily in AI-driven revenue management, acquiring Bounteous in 2021 to enhance its data analytics and machine learning capabilities. In 2022,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C announced a partnership with Google Cloud to accelerate digital transformation, leveraging Google’s AI and data tools to offer personalized guest experiences. By 2024, the company had integrated blockchain technology for secure, transparent bookings and implemented sustainability metrics to help hotels reduce their carbon footprint. Today,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C is at the forefront of contactless technology, voice-activated room controls, and predictive analytics that forecast guest preferences. Its journey from a legacy CRS provider to a cloud-based, AI-powered ecosystem illustrates a commitment to continuous innovation and adaptation. The company’s history is marked by resilience, particularly during economic downturns, where it helped hotels pivot to new revenue streams such as dynamic pricing and ancillary services. With a strong R&D pipeline and a culture of experimentation,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C is poised to lead the next wave of hospitality technology, including the integration of metaverse experiences and biometric check-ins.

Products, Technologies, and Services

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C offers a comprehensive suite of products that cover the entire hotel lifecycle. The flagship product is the Sabre SynXis Platform, a cloud-based central reservation system (CRS) that integrates directly with global distribution systems (GDS), online travel agencies (OTAs), and direct booking engines. Key modules include:

  • SynXis Central Reservation – Real-time inventory and rate management across all channels.
  • SynXis Hospitality Cloud – A microservices-based platform for scalability and customization.
  • SynXis Property Management (PMS) – Front desk, housekeeping, billing, and reporting tools.
  • SynXis Revenue Management – AI-driven dynamic pricing and demand forecasting.
  • SynXis Guest Engagement – Mobile app, pre-arrival communication, and loyalty integration.
  • SynXis Data & Analytics – Dashboards for performance metrics, competitive benchmarking, and customer insights.
  • SynXis Distribution – Seamless connectivity with 600+ OTA and GDS channels.
  • SynXis Insights – Machine learning models for personalized offers and cross-selling.

Technologically,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C leverages artificial intelligence for automated pricing, chatbots for guest support, and IoT for smart room controls. The company also provides Sabre API Marketplace where hotels can access best-in-class third-party solutions, and Sabre Travel AI for predictive analytics. Services include 24/7 technical support, onboarding consulting, training programs, and a customer success team. For large enterprises, Sabre offers dedicated account management and customized integrations. The platform is built on a high-availability cloud infrastructure, ensuring 99.9% uptime. Security is paramount, with end-to-end encryption, PCI-DSS compliance, and regular penetration testing. Additionally, Sabre Hospitality Solutions LLC provides white-label solutions for hotels to create branded mobile apps and booking engines. Recent innovations include voice-activated booking via Amazon Alexa and AI-generated content for marketing campaigns. By continuously updating its product backlog based on client feedback, Sabre maintains a competitive edge in a fast-evolving market.

Job Details & Requirements for this Posting

Senior Product Manager – Travel Technology

We are seeking a dynamic Senior Product Manager to lead the evolution of our revenue management and guest engagement products. This role sits at the intersection of technology and hospitality, requiring deep domain knowledge of hotel operations and a passion for data-driven solutions. You will own the product roadmap, collaborate with engineering teams, and work directly with major hotel chains to define requirements. The ideal candidate has 7+ years of product management experience, preferably in travel tech or SaaS. Responsibilities include:

  • Define product vision, strategy, and quarterly OKRs based on market research and client feedback.
  • Lead cross-functional squads of engineers, designers, and data scientists to deliver features on time and within budget.
  • Conduct user research, A/B testing, and competitive analysis to prioritize backlog.
  • Manage stakeholder communication, including executive presentations and client demos.
  • Track product KPIs such as adoption rates, revenue impact, and customer satisfaction.
  • Champion the integration of AI/ML capabilities to optimize pricing and personalization.
  • Ensure compliance with global data regulations (GDPR, CCPA) and security standards.

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Business, or Hospitality; MBA preferred. Proven track record of launching successful B2B platforms. Strong analytical skills with SQL and data visualization tools. Excellent communication and negotiation abilities. Passion for travel and a user-centric mindset.
